Specify the font for text by changing the font settings. How to Customize WordPad Document. Right-click on blank area in Desktop or File Explorer, select New > Rich Text Document.File FormatKMZ - The KMZ format is a compressed form of the KML format which is used for displaying the maps in Google Earth. A strong familiarity with regular expressions is needed to develop custom syntaxes. Change the appearance of a WordPad document.Syntax definitions rely heavily on regular expressions to identify patterns in text. Here you can even insert a image, if you like.Syntax definition files are stored in JSON format with UTF-8 encoding. If using Read Mode, then select the. For all document views other than Read Mode, then check the Navigation Pane checkbox in the Show button group. To show the Navigation pane in Word, click the View tab in the Ribbon. The.The Navigation pane in Word lets you quickly search or navigate through your document.
DraftsSyntax file extension, but internally these are JSON files. When distributed, Drafts exports and imports using the. Additional keys will be ignored. Primarily Used For Text Document Navigation Software Used ByWith the computer and listen to what is displayed as text (usually) on the screen.Drafts does not have a built-in editor for syntax definitions. MacWrite soon fell from first place in the Mac word processing market, displaced by Microsoft Word , which has remained the most popular Mac word processing program ever since.A screen reader is a voice synthesis software used by the visually. MacWrtite 1.0 held an entire document in RAM, and due to limited RAM in the original Mac, it could only handle a few pages of text. The normal usage of the app and not require the user to navigate into a menu or settings. In Drafts, choose an existing built-in or custom syntax that most closely matches the syntax you wish to develop. These steps apply on both iOS and macOS. Workflow for Editing SyntaxesGenerally speaking, the recommended workflow for developing a custom syntax is as below. There are many, the one we typically use is Regex 101.Once a syntax definition is complete, it can be imported into Drafts to be used, and, if desired, shared to the Drafts Directory for other users. For details, see developer mode information.Since syntax definitions rely heavily on regular expression, we also recommend use of a regular expression tool/app to work on testing and regular expression patterns. As you iterate and make changes to your syntax, save the file, and reload it in Drafts by either selecting a different draft and returning to your testing draft, or re-assigning the syntax to force it to reload from file. In Drafts, create a testing draft with sample text for your syntax, and select your new file-based syntax as the syntax assigned to the draft. Open your new syntax file in an external JSON editor, make your modifications, and save the file. Save this file in iCloud Drive/Drafts/Library/Syntaxes (you may have to create this folder). Dvla d1 application form downloadgrammar-simple list.json: Simple List syntax currently used in Drafts. grammar-javascript.json: JavaScript syntax currently used in Drafts. grammar-markdown.json: Markdown syntax currently used in Drafts. The imported custom syntax can be used in regular production mode.If you are making modifications to a syntax you have worked on in the past, when you use the “Import” feature, you will be offered the option to replace the version you have imported in the past, or import as a new custom syntax. author : Source credit for who created this theme. Used in user interface for selection. name : A friendly name for the Syntax definition. Demo-Tasks.json: Demostrates a few more advanced possibilities for tappable/clickable task elements in text.The root of the JSON file should be a object which defines the following root element keys: This text will be displayed in the syntax manager in Drafts. sampleText : A brief sample text that demonstrates key features supported in the syntax. Markdown can be included and will be rendered if this syntax is posted to the Directory. Used in user interface elements to assist user in selecting syntaxes. description : Description of the syntax with more details about what is supported by the definition. line: The entire containing line of the changed text. Syntax definitions should select the least of these as necessary to ensure that changes to the text are properly reflected. It is also possible to have separate iOS and macOS entries if it makes sense to have different rangeExtensionTypes by platform for performance reasons. Most objects will have a single default entry. linkDefinitions : Used to create live links within a document. patterns : Pattern definitions for the syntax. fullText: Re-evaluate the entire text when any changes occur. lookAround2000: Extend evaluated range up to 2000 characters before and after the changes. lookAround1000: Extend evaluated range up to 1000 characters before and after the changes. lookAround500: Extend evaluated range up to 500 characters before and after the changes. indentationPatterns : Definitions used to define blocks with indentation, such as Markdown lists. See Navigation Patterns for details. navigationPatterns : Definitions used to build in-document navigation markers. ![]() ![]() Scopes will be applied in the order listed, so if attributes from one scope may override attributes from another, so be careful of ordering. Scopes are sets of font traits and styles which are defined in themes. scope : Comma-separated list of scope names to apply to this capture group. : Key for object should be integer index of the capture group it applies to. If the match expression contains additional capture group, each should be included by index, like “1”, “2”, etc. “0” will always be the entire match result. ExampleBelow is a partial patterns object with two example patterns to perform syntax highlighting on Markdown heading lines and on horizontal rule markup. It is important to plan correctly using the exclusive property and or the correct ordering of patterns to prevent subsequent patterns from overriding scope values for previously styled text where undesirable. If the exclusive value for the parent pattern is true, this is ignored, but allows a capture group within a pattern override the parent to be considered exclusive.Patterns are applied in order. If true, the text range matched by this capture group will be considered complete and not evaluated for matches by and subsequent patterns defined in the syntax.
0 Comments
Leave a Reply. |
AuthorAngela ArchivesCategories |